Job Title: Project Engineer – Study & Planning Phase
Location: JHB/Witbank
Job Type: 12 month contract, expected to work Full‑Time hours
Job Duties:
  • Proven work experience in a project environment.
  • Background in the mining industry (run‑of‑mine crushing/sizing/screening, beneficiation plants, contract mining setup) is highly desirable, with exposure to plant and equipment layouts.
  • Co‑ordinate all aspects of planning and design, feasibility studies, risk analysis, optimisation, design, scheduling and contractor/supplier selection justification.
  • Self‑motivated and self‑driven is preferable.
  • Provide technical support to ensure the successful completion of the feasibility study and the detailed engineering design phase.
  • Co‑ordinate or assist with the co‑ordination of all project execution activities related to the delivery of engineering infrastructure that will support the contract miner and development of the greenfields mine.
  • Ensure Project expectations are met, schedules maintained, and budgets adhered to.
  • Source, appoint, and manage engineering contractors.
  • Liaise regularly with engineering design consultants and plant design contractors including leading project engineering kick‑off and progress meetings.
  • Manage and plan design activities to ensure timely completion and co‑ordination within the design team throughout all phases.
  • Conduct project alignment meetings between the relevant stakeholders of the project.
  • Work with project planners and schedulers to understand timelines and ensure progress reports are accurate and meet required standards before release to steercom.
  • Collaborate with the design and drafting department of the design consultants to establish required deliverables; check designs and drawings for alignment with agreed engineering design criteria, mine standards and specifications.
  • Ensure equipment designs comply with project requirements and expectations.
  • Manage the overall Project Blockplan. Ensure that it’s updated timeously and approved by relevant stakeholders.
  • Maintain continuous alignment of engineering project scope with mine business objectives and make recommendations to modify the project to enhance effectiveness in achieving business results or strategic intent.
  • Manage the compilation and integration of the Engineering Study reports including Study work plans and Project Execution plans at the end of the feasibility study.
  • Responsible for quality of engineering deliverables.
